It was one of those first‑of‑spring afternoons when the garden was finally waking up, the air smelled like fresh rain on newly sprouted leaves, and my little niece was running around with a bright pink bucket, collecting the first tender peas she could find. I was in the kitchen, stirring a pot that had been simmering for half an hour, when the lid lifted and a cloud of fragrant steam rushed out, carrying hints of sweet tomatoes, earthy thyme, and the bright green pop of peas. That moment—when the aroma wrapped itself around the whole house like a warm, comforting blanket—made me realize that soups are more than just food; they’re memories in a bowl. I decided then to capture that exact feeling in a recipe that could be pulled out whenever the season calls for a little sunshine on a plate.
Spring Minestrone isn’t just another vegetable soup; it’s a celebration of the season’s bounty, a dish that lets you hear the sizzle of olive oil hitting the pan, feel the gentle snap of fresh beans, and taste the subtle kiss of thyme that lingers on the palate. The secret is in the balance—each vegetable brings its own texture, from the buttery softness of zucchini to the firm bite of carrots, while the tiny pasta pearls add a comforting chew that feels like a hug from the inside. Imagine ladling a steaming bowl onto a rustic wooden table, sprinkling a handful of fresh basil on top, and watching the colors swirl like a miniature garden in a pot. That’s the kind of visual and sensory experience we’re aiming for, and trust me, your family will be asking for seconds before the last spoonful hits the sink.
But wait—there’s a twist that makes this version stand out from the countless minestrone recipes you’ll find online. I discovered a tiny, almost‑secret ingredient that adds a depth of flavor you’d expect only from a slow‑cooked broth, yet it takes just minutes to incorporate. I won’t spill the beans just yet (pun intended), but keep reading because that revelation will change the way you think about quick, fresh soups forever. And if you’re wondering whether you need a pantry full of exotic spices, the answer is a resounding no—this recipe thrives on what’s already in your fridge and a few pantry staples.
Here’s exactly how to make it — and trust me, your family will be asking for seconds. Grab a pot, a wooden spoon, and a willingness to let the kitchen become your playground. As you follow each step, you’ll notice little moments where the soup seems to whisper its own story, and I’ll share those moments with you, right alongside the practical tips that keep everything smooth. Ready? Let’s dive in and discover why this Spring Minestrone is destined to become a beloved staple in your culinary rotation.
🌟 Why This Recipe Works
- Flavor Depth: The combination of fresh tomatoes, aromatic thyme, and a splash of olive oil creates a layered taste that deepens as the soup rests, giving you that “slow‑cooked” richness without hours on the stove.
- Texture Harmony: By using a mix of crunchy carrots, tender zucchini, and al dente pasta, each spoonful delivers a satisfying bite that keeps the palate interested from the first sip to the last.
- Ease of Execution: The recipe follows a logical sequence—sauté, simmer, add pasta—so even a kitchen novice can glide through the steps with confidence, and you’ll never feel lost.
- Time Efficiency: In under 45 minutes you have a wholesome, restaurant‑quality soup on the table, making it perfect for busy weeknights when you still crave something home‑cooked.
- Versatility: Swap out vegetables based on what’s in season or what you have on hand; the base flavors are forgiving enough to accommodate carrots for parsnips, peas for corn, or even a handful of kale.
- Nutrition Boost: Packed with fiber‑rich vegetables, plant‑based protein from the beans and peas, and a modest amount of healthy fat from olive oil, this soup fuels both body and soul.
- Crowd‑Pleaser Factor: The bright colors and comforting aromas make it an instant hit with kids and adults alike, and the subtle herb notes keep it sophisticated enough for a dinner party.
🥗 Ingredients Breakdown
The Foundation: Olive Oil & Aromatics
Olive oil is the silent hero of this soup, providing a silky mouthfeel while helping to coax out the natural sweetness of the onions, carrots, and celery. When you heat the oil until it shimmers, you’re creating a glossy base that carries flavor throughout the pot. Choose a cold‑pressed, extra‑virgin variety for the most robust fruitiness, but if you prefer a higher smoke point, a light olive oil works just as well. The onions, diced finely, become translucent and sweet, forming the aromatic backbone that supports every other ingredient.
Aromatics & Spices: Garlic, Thyme, & Salt
Garlic adds that unmistakable punch that instantly makes you think of home cooking; mincing it finely ensures it distributes evenly, releasing its essential oils. Dried thyme, with its earthy, slightly floral notes, is the herb that ties the garden vegetables together, and because it’s dried, it infuses the broth quickly—no need to wait for fresh sprigs to soften. Salt and pepper are the final seasoning layers; they amplify the natural flavors, but remember, you can always adjust at the end, so start light and build up.
The Secret Weapons: Green Beans, Peas, & Pasta
Green beans bring a crisp snap that contrasts beautifully with the softer carrots and zucchini, while peas add a burst of sweetness and a pop of vibrant green that makes the soup look as festive as a spring garden. If you’re using frozen peas, there’s no need to thaw—they’ll heat up quickly and retain their bright color. The small pasta, such as ditalini, is the heart of the minestrone, turning the broth into a hearty meal; its size ensures it cooks evenly and doesn’t dominate the vegetable medley.
Finishing Touches: Fresh Basil & Final Seasoning
Fresh basil is the final flourish, adding a bright, peppery aroma that lifts the entire bowl just before serving. Tear the leaves by hand rather than cutting them; this preserves the delicate oils and prevents the basil from turning bitter. A final drizzle of olive oil can also add a glossy finish, making each spoonful look as inviting as it tastes. Trust me, that last sprinkle of basil is the moment when you realize the soup has transformed from simple ingredients to a celebration of spring.
With your ingredients prepped and ready, let's get cooking. Here's where the fun really begins...
🍳 Step-by-Step Instructions
-
Heat the 2 tablespoons of olive oil in a large soup pot over medium heat until it shimmers, then add the chopped onion. Sauté the onion for about 4–5 minutes, stirring occasionally, until it becomes translucent and starts to caramelize at the edges. You’ll notice a sweet, almost nutty scent developing—that’s the first sign the flavor foundation is forming. If the onions begin to brown too quickly, lower the heat to avoid bitterness.
💡 Pro Tip: Add a pinch of sugar with the onions if you want a deeper caramelization without burning. -
Add the diced carrots and celery to the pot, stirring them into the softened onions. Cook for another 3–4 minutes, allowing the vegetables to release their natural juices and soften slightly. Listen for the gentle sizzle as the carrots begin to soften—this is the sound of flavor building. At this point, you can taste a tiny piece of carrot; it should still have a faint crunch, indicating it will retain texture after the final simmer.
-
Introduce the minced garlic and cook for 30 seconds, just until you smell the aromatic perfume of garlic waking up. Be careful not to let it brown; burnt garlic can turn bitter and ruin the delicate balance of the soup. As soon as the garlic becomes fragrant, sprinkle in the dried thyme, stirring quickly to coat the vegetables. This brief toast of herbs releases their essential oils, setting the stage for a deeper flavor profile.
-
Pour in the 4 cups of vegetable broth and the 14‑oz can of diced tomatoes, including their juices. Bring the mixture to a gentle boil, then reduce the heat to a simmer. As the soup bubbles, you’ll see the colors meld into a beautiful ruby‑red base. Let it simmer uncovered for about 10 minutes, allowing the vegetables to become tender and the broth to thicken slightly.
⚠️ Common Mistake: Leaving the lid on while simmering traps steam, resulting in a watery soup; keep it uncovered to let excess liquid evaporate. -
Add the diced zucchini, chopped green beans, and peas to the pot. These quick‑cooking vegetables only need about 5 minutes to become tender yet retain a pleasant snap. Stir gently so the vegetables distribute evenly without breaking apart. The moment the peas turn a vivid green is your cue that they’re perfectly cooked—overcooked peas lose their bright color and become mushy.
-
Season the soup with salt and pepper to taste, remembering to start with a modest amount—you can always add more later. Taste a spoonful; the broth should be balanced, with the acidity of the tomatoes offset by the sweetness of the vegetables. If you feel the soup needs a touch more depth, a splash of soy sauce or a pinch of smoked paprika can add complexity without overwhelming the fresh flavors.
-
Stir in the small pasta (ditalini or any bite‑size shape) and let it cook according to the package instructions, usually 8–10 minutes. Keep the soup at a gentle simmer, stirring occasionally to prevent the pasta from sticking to the bottom. As the pasta absorbs the broth, it will swell and become tender, turning the soup into a filling meal.
💡 Pro Tip: Reserve a cup of the cooking water before draining the pasta; adding a splash later can adjust the soup’s consistency if it gets too thick. -
Once the pasta is al dente, turn off the heat and fold in a handful of fresh basil leaves, tearing them gently to release their aroma. The residual heat will wilt the basil just enough to keep its bright flavor intact. Let the soup rest for a minute or two; this resting period lets the flavors meld even further, creating that “made‑ahead” taste that many restaurant soups boast about.
-
Give the soup a final taste, adjusting salt, pepper, or a drizzle of extra‑virgin olive oil if needed. Serve hot in bowls, garnished with a few more basil leaves for color and a sprinkle of grated Parmesan if you like. The steam rising from each bowl should carry the scent of herbs, tomatoes, and fresh vegetables, inviting everyone to dive in.
And there you have it! But before you dig in, let me share some tips that will take this from great to absolutely unforgettable...
🔐 Expert Tips for Perfect Results
The Taste Test Trick
Never underestimate the power of a mid‑cooking taste test. About halfway through simmering, scoop a spoonful and let it cool just enough to taste. This is the moment to adjust seasoning, add a pinch more thyme, or balance acidity with a dash of sugar if the tomatoes are too sharp. Trust your palate; it knows exactly what the soup needs.
Why Resting Time Matters More Than You Think
Even after you turn off the heat, letting the soup sit for 5–10 minutes allows the flavors to marry. The pasta continues to absorb some broth, creating a silkier texture, while the herbs release their essential oils. I once served the soup straight away and felt something was missing; after a short rest, the difference was night and day.
The Seasoning Secret Pros Won’t Tell You
A splash of good‑quality balsamic vinegar added at the very end brightens the entire bowl, giving it a subtle tang that lifts the earthy vegetables. It’s a trick chefs use to add depth without extra salt. Just a teaspoon is enough—don’t overdo it, or you’ll mask the fresh flavors.
Cooking Pasta Directly in the Soup
Adding pasta directly to the broth, rather than cooking it separately, lets the starches thicken the soup naturally. This technique eliminates the need for extra thickening agents and gives the soup a cohesive, hearty body. Just keep an eye on the liquid level; you may need to add a splash more broth if it looks too thick.
The Power of Fresh Herbs at the End
Adding fresh herbs like basil or parsley at the very end preserves their bright, aromatic qualities. If you add them too early, the heat can dull their flavor. I’ve found that a quick toss of chopped basil right before serving makes the soup feel lighter and more vibrant.
🌈 Delicious Variations to Try
One of my favorite things about this recipe is how versatile it is. Here are some twists I've tried and loved:
Rustic Bean Boost
Swap the peas for a cup of cooked cannellini beans and add a pinch of smoked paprika. The beans add a creamy texture, while the paprika introduces a subtle smoky note that feels almost autumnal, yet still bright enough for spring.
Mediterranean Spin
Replace the zucchini with diced eggplant and add a handful of kalamata olives. The eggplant absorbs the broth beautifully, and the olives contribute a briny punch that pairs wonderfully with the fresh basil.
Spicy Kick
Stir in a finely chopped red chili or a dash of crushed red pepper flakes when you add the garlic. This adds a gentle heat that awakens the palate without overpowering the delicate vegetable flavors.
Creamy Coconut Twist
For a dairy‑free, creamy version, replace half of the vegetable broth with coconut milk and add a teaspoon of curry powder. The coconut adds richness, while the curry brings an exotic warmth that transforms the soup into a tropical delight.
Hearty Grain Upgrade
Swap the pasta for a half‑cup of cooked farro or barley. These grains give the soup a nutty flavor and a chewy texture, making it even more filling—perfect for a chilly evening when you need extra sustenance.
📦 Storage & Reheating Tips
Refrigerator Storage
Allow the soup to cool to room temperature before transferring it to airtight containers. It will keep fresh for up to 4 days in the fridge. When reheating, add a splash of water or broth to revive the broth’s consistency, as the pasta will continue to absorb liquid over time.
Freezing Instructions
Portion the soup into freezer‑safe bags or containers, leaving about an inch of headspace for expansion. It freezes well for up to 3 months. For best results, freeze the soup without the pasta; add freshly cooked pasta when you reheat to maintain the ideal texture.
Reheating Methods
Reheat gently on the stovetop over low heat, stirring occasionally, until steaming hot. If using a microwave, heat in 1‑minute intervals, stirring in between, to ensure even warming. The trick to reheating without drying it out? A splash of extra‑virgin olive oil or a drizzle of broth right before serving restores the silky mouthfeel.